Abstract
A method for highly efficient data sharding includes: receiving a dataset containing event data; identifying a classifier field of the dataset; identifying an event field of the dataset; generating a data structure for the dataset using the classifier field and the event field; and storing the dataset by partitioning the dataset into shards using the classifier field as a shard key and ordering data within each shard by the classifier field.
